Gravitational Field warps gravity over a targeted area, crushing every enemy inside it with repeated bursts of Neutral magic.
Overview
On VortexRo, Gravitational Field is reworked into a renewal-style ground field. The caster places the field on the ground and is then free to move, cast, and act — there is no self-lock holding you in place. While the field lasts, every enemy standing in it is struck again and again by gravity-magic. The effect is a short, high-pressure burst of area damage rather than a long channel.
Mechanics
The field is laid down on the ground at the chosen spot and pulls on a small area around it. Enemies caught inside take repeated magic hits for as long as the field persists.
Damage formula: each hit deals (100 × SkillLv)% MATK — that is 100% at level 1, 200%, 300%, 400%, and 500% MATK at level 5.
Hit cadence: the field damages every target inside it roughly every 0.55 seconds. The field's lifetime grows with level, so higher levels both hit harder per pulse and last longer, producing more total pulses.
The damage is Neutral-element magic and ignores flinch (targets are not staggered by it). The Emperium takes a fixed amount when struck.
Leveling
| Level | SP cost | Per-hit damage (MATK) | Field duration |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| 60 | 100% | 1.0 sec |
| 2 | 70 | 200% | 1.5 sec |
| 3 | 80 | 300% | 2.0 sec |
| 4 | 90 | 400% | 2.5 sec |
| 5 | 100 | 500% | 3.5 sec |
Notes
- The caster is not locked in place while the field is active — you may move and cast freely after placing it.
- The cast time is a fixed 5 seconds and the skill has a 5-second cooldown.
